Federal Service Tribunal reserves verdict on case filed by FBR employees

byNaeem Ullah Tariq
25/02/2016
in Islamabad, Latest News
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

ISLAMABAD: The Federal Service Tribunal on Wednesday reserved a judgment on a case filed by employees of the Federal Board of Revenue (FRB).

A division bench of the FST comprising Members, Arshad Bhatti and Javed Iqbal Kasi, heard the “review” petition regarding the case of up-gradation from BPS-13 to BPS-16 of superintendent.

Three identical petitions were clubbed in the case filed by FBR staffers, Ayaz Hussain, Muhammad Younas and Syed Munawar Ali.

The appellants had pleaded the tribunal to review the matter and issue afresh directions to the department for their up-gradation.

The bench on the day completed hearing of arguments and reserved the judgment likely to be announced in coming days.
